Are there any transfer program of Diploma / Degree in Singapore?

Hello there,

     I'm searching for a software engineering diploma/degree program which helps to transfer into Canada, Australia or else a Europe country for further studies. I have a BSc Hons in computing degree ( UK ). Besides, I have 4 years of experience as a software engineer. And I'm from Sri Lanka.

The extreme scope of this approach is to immigrate into another country to obtain a permanent residency and also get work experience.

Any advice would be highly appreciated.

Your approach is far-fetched!
If you want to move to country A, you should work towards moving to country A, not country B.
If you want to study in Singapore (which has excellent universities), then you are welcome to do it. But it won't give you more chances in other countries than a university degree in general.
Work experience (and permanent residence) require a job, not a university course.

Do you know about after study industry training programmes(internship)?  That's where I'm going to touch. Some universities provide opportunities to work for reputed organisations and secure the job fo skilled people. Also, transfer to another country to further development.

The universities all have partnerships with foreign schools, which give some students the opportunity of going abroad for one or more semesters. Also, all have industry partnerships with certain companies (usually local, or local branches of foreign ones), which provide internship opportunities for students.
You can find details on the university webpages, or you can contact them to ask.
